GREENVILLE, N.C. — An East Carolina University fraternity is suspended after police found a large amount of drugs at their fraternity house, according to NBC affiliate WITN.

Greenville police on Tuesday officers seized more that 2,500 Xanax bars from the Phi Kappa Tau Fraternity House and arrested four frat members.

In addition to the drugs, police seized two shotguns and discovered that marijuana was being sold from the house.

Police say the raid was the culmination of a three-week long investigation by the Greenville Regional Drug Task Force.
